Handover — Pell to incoming contractor. Welcome aboard! The Gabblefinch service is absurdly chatty, so we sample logs at 5% in prod via the Siftrell pipeline. Don't bump the rate without checking index costs first — we learned that the hard way. Config lives in the sampling repo; errors and payment paths are always kept at 100%. To unlock the Siftrell admin console for your first change, use the recovery passphrase below.

strongbox words: fraath-isteth

Handover note — Crumbwheel order cutoffs.

Welcome aboard. The bakery cutoff rule in Crumbwheel closes same-day orders at 14:00 local to each storefront, not UTC — this has bitten us twice. Holiday overrides live in the calendar service and take precedence silently, so always check there first when a cutoff looks wrong. To unlock the calendar service's admin console after a restart, enter the recovery passphrase below.

vault phrase of bagap-bahaf = silion-pelox-sorox-casdor-quenwyn-fraax-eliox-praael-kelion-quenvan-kasox-rusael-norius-belvan

Handover re: static-analysis baseline. The baseline file in lint-config freezes ~1,200 legacy findings so CI only fails on new issues. Don't regenerate it casually — that hides regressions. If a fix clears old findings, prune those entries manually in the same PR. Regeneration procedure and review checklist are on the internal page below.

operations page: https://jenkins.zemvarcloud.local/job/merge_requests/repo/build/73930b4b30f0a8ed

// Security review context: this client talks to Gatewright, the service that
// enforces our canary deploy gating rules. A canary is promoted only if error
// rate stays under 0.5% and p99 latency under 250ms for 30 consecutive
// minutes; either breach triggers automatic rollback via the Rollstone
// controller. Note that gating decisions are signed and audited — do not
// bypass this client with raw HTTP calls. Gatewright authentication uses the
// key immediately below.

API key for fawif-tagug: zpat23_QjTqt2Aqb25emwQY8KmpH4K